Day 12 “Glorify Jesus”

Countdown to Pentecost – Day 12

“Glorify Jesus”

“He shall glorify me: for he shall receive of mine and shall shew it unto you”  John 16:14

We live in a time when everyone seems to be trying to become famous, gain followers, and become influencers on social media.  However, Jesus told his disciples that the Holy Spirit, who he spoke of as “the Spirit of truth,” would “glorify” him.  For Christians this means that the Holy Spirit is to make Jesus famous, gain followers of Christ and influence others to receive him.  In other words, it’s not about us, it’s about Jesus. 

As we embrace the spirit-filled life, we should constantly judge ourselves and question our motives.  Is this going to bring Jesus glory, or it is only going to promote me?  Will Jesus get glory out of this endeavor, this business, this opportunity?  When we are led by the Holy Spirit, it’s all about Jesus.  As a result of making Jesus famous and bringing glory to him,  God will also reward us for our faithfulness to him.  

I want to encourage you to not get distracted by others who are building their own kingdoms, promoting themselves and trying to “be great.”  Jesus said that in the kingdom of God, being great comes from serving others.  As we serve Jesus by serving others, he provides for us, promotes us in his time, and gives us favor with God and man.  Our goal should be to “glorify him.”
